Yes. Create the other account. When you are logged in to 1 of them, from your own home feed page at the top middle is your username. Click that and it will bring a drop-down where you can add an account. You'll then enter the credentials for the other account and it will link them. You'll switch back & forth between the 2 accounts from that same area.
